Action item (PM-214): Add recurring load tests for the Carthaven checkout flow. Peak-hour failure went undetected because staging traffic never exceeded 5% of real volume. Owner: Verity, due next sprint. Gate releases on a 3x-peak pass. Test profiles and run instructions live on the internal page linked below.

dashboard of tawef-hagug = https://superset.norvadyn.local/display/projects/build/ticket/build/spaces/ticket/1e989f0e6c200d20fc4ae06b

Before archiving a cold storage bucket in Glacierette, detach all plugin hooks. Run the freeze job, confirm checksum parity, then revoke scoped tokens. Do not delete manifests; the Vexhall recovery service reads them during account restoration. If the bucket owner's account is locked, trigger the recovery flow from the Opsgate console, not the plugin API. Archival completes within 20 minutes. Plugins must tolerate 404s on frozen objects. To unseal the restore job, use the passphrase below.

vault phrase of fawig-yagug = tamix-norys-ulaix-joreth-druius-jorael-briax-prair-lamael-caseth-brivan-lamius-istius

### Step 3: Resolve the calendar sync conflict

If you're on call and SyncLark is double-booking events after the 4.2 upgrade, it's probably the old conflict-resolution flag still set to "last-write-wins." Flip it to "merge" in the tenant config, then replay the stuck sync jobs from the last six hours. You'll want to verify the replayed rows actually landed in the conflicts table. Connect to the sync metadata database with the following:

replica DSN, kajep-yahag: mssql://praok_svc:iF@db-8d68.plorvaio.local:5432/eliion

The Farelab ticket-pricing experiment service rejected last night's config push with a signature mismatch, so the new fare variants never went live and all venues fell back to baseline pricing. Root cause: the config was signed with the retired staging key after last week's rotation. No customer-facing pricing errors occurred. Support should tell experimenters to re-sign configs with the current key and resubmit; pushes verified against it deploy normally. The active verification key is below.

release key, bahof-hafog: bky3_ztf